Instant Pot Pork Belly Recipe

Pork belly might be the world’s most popular and beloved food. It’s considered a delicacy in dozens of countries throughout Asia, Europe and South America. And we love our pork belly here in the States too… as proven by the menus of tapas bars and bistros across the country. As a testament to its popularity, the USDA reports that in 2017 national inventories of frozen pork belly hit their … [Read more...]

 Name: Email: We respect your email privacyEmail Marketing by AWeber